The second outdoor meet for the Virginia Union University men's track team was held at Livingstone College on Saturday, March 29.
The Panthers made a strong showing, with several standout performances and personal bests.

"The Blue Bear Invitational was a strong meet for us, with 85% of our athletes achieving personal bests in their events," said VUU Head Track & Field Coach Franck Charles. "This is a great sign of progress for both our athletes and coaching staff, though we still have areas to improve as we continue the season. Congratulations for a great job by everyone who competed!"
VUU will now compete in the Norfolk State University Invitational on April 4 and 5 in Norfolk, Va.
